Certified Inpatient Coder Salary in the United States

How much does a Certified Inpatient Coder make in the United States? The salary range for a Certified Inpatient Coder job is from $33,772 to $51,427 per year in the United States. States with Higher Salaries for Certified Inpatient Coder

The five states where Certified Inpatient Coder jobs get higher salaries in the United States are: District of Columbia, California, New Jersey, Alaska, and Massachusetts. Compared with the average salary of a Certified Inpatient Coder in the United States, the state of District of Columbia with the highest job income for this job. The second and third states are California and New Jersey respectively. The high or low salary paid to Certified Inpatient Coder by the US has a greater relationship with the demand for jobs and the cost of living.
